Job Description:
The Recruitment Co-Ordinator will work closely with the HR Team to manage our Student Placement and Graduate placement programmes, supporting the identification of top talent for the organisation and proactively managing a diverse talent pipeline.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Enhance Employer Brand: Promote the company culture, values, and benefits to attract high-quality candidates, including College Placement Students and Graduates.
2. BUILDING PARTNERSHIPS: Build and maintain relationships with universities and career services to uncover opportunities for sourcing top graduate talent.
3. CAREER FAIR COORDINATION: Coordinate and oversee logistics for career fairs, including event planning and reservations.
4. REPRESENTATION: Represent Walls Construction at career fairs, showcasing the company's opportunities.
5. Talent Management: Manage our College Student Placement programme and Graduate Placement programme.
6. ADVERTISEMENT: Advertise placement opportunities and Graduate positions with relevant colleges.
7. ONBOARDING AND OFFBOARDING: Manage the onboarding and offboarding of student placements, including organizing end-of-placement presentations.
8. PEFORMANCE REVIEW: Ensure that reviews are completed for Students before their leaving date.
9. HUMAN RESOURCES ADMINISTRATION: Input new starter details on the HR system and collate and follow up on documentation, training certificates, etc., required.
10. CANDIDATE SOURCING: Source qualified candidates, review CVs, and pre-screen candidates while moving the interview process forward in a timely manner.
11. CANDIDATE COMMUNICATION: Manage communications with candidates regarding progress and outcomes of interviews.
12. COORDINATION: Coordinate key activities associated with the onboarding process.
13. VISA ASSISTANCE: Assist with Work Permit and Visa applications.
14. AGENCY RELATIONS: Manage relations with agency partners through proactive engagement.
15. SYSTEM MAINTENANCE: Maintain recruitment systems on a daily/weekly basis to ensure information is kept up-to-date for weekly and monthly reports.
16. HR COLLABORATION: Engage with the wider HR team and relevant Site Teams ahead of new joiners starting to ensure a smooth onboarding experience.
17. FINANCIAL MANAGEMENT: Raise PO requests to ensure timely payment of recruitment invoices.
18. SOCIAL MEDIA PROMOTION: Post recruitment adverts across all relevant social media platforms, job boards, etc.
19. MAILBOX MONITORING: Monitor the recruitment mailbox.
20. STAYING UP TO DATE: Keep up to date with current recruitment trends and best practices and actively participate in initiatives to continually improve the quality and efficiency of our sourcing, recruitment, and hiring processes.
21. EVALUATION: Conduct exit interviews and develop quarterly and annual reports.
